Definition of vaporous - Reverso English Dictionary
Adjective
1.
gasRare related to or having the characteristics of vaporRare
- The vaporous clouds drifted across the sky.
2.
scienceRare US emitting or giving off vaporRare US
- The vaporous geyser erupted with force.
3.
illusionRare US insubstantial or illusoryRare US
- Her promises were as vaporous as fog, disappearing with the slightest scrutiny..
Origin of vaporous
Latin, vaporosus (full of vapor)
